Tracer replacement leads with site holster, designed for durability and convenience on busy job sites. Maximum protection, purpose-built for site use Ideal for fine lines, writing, and deep, bold marking New anti-snap lead dispenser for added durability Easily accessible when used with the Tracer site holster Includes six 120mm leads: 4 x 2B graphite for dark, clear lines and 2 x yellow leads for marking on darker surfaces

To measure for fascia boards, simply measure the length of the roof edge where the boards will be fitted. For full replacement, also measure the height from the bottom of the rafters to just under the roof tiles. Don’t forget to account for joins, corners, and end caps, and it's always smart to add a little extra to allow for cuts and adjustments.

Capping boards (also known as ‘cap-over’ boards) are thinner and designed to be fitted over existing timber fascias that are still in good condition. Full replacement fascia boards are thicker, stronger, and used when replacing old timber completely. If the existing timber is damaged or rotting, full replacement is the way to go.
